EC deploys personnel in Volta Region for registration exercise

Ho, July 31, GNA – The Electoral Commission will deploy 1,081 personnel in the Volta Region during the 11-day limited registration exercise that began on Thursday.

The exercise is for those who have attained the voting age of 18 or those who have never registered, Ms Laurentia Kpatakpa, Volta Regional Director of the Electoral Commission, told the GNA in an interview. She said the exercise would take place in 259 registration centres throughout the region.

Mrs Kpatakpa said whereas there would be fixed registration centres in the urban areas, registration teams would be on the move in the rural areas where the problem of distance and transportation difficulties could prevent many eligible voters from travelling to the district capitals to register. She said political parties and chiefs have been contacted to help inform the people especially rural communities about the exercise. Ms Kpatakpa said adequate financial arrangements have been made for the payment of allowances, transport and travel expenses of the registration teams.

She said those who have lost their voter identity cards would be eligible to register for new ones only after thorough screening. Ms Kpatakpa said those who have moved from where they were originally registered would be given the opportunity to apply for the transfer of their votes 21 days to the December election.
